Yes. The carpet bombing of trapped German forces by the U.S. 8th and 9th air forces during Operation Goodwood was devastating. Of course, it only worked because it was directed against vehicles in woods and open country, and the bombardment was massive. Bombs against infantry in built up areas resulted in some casualties, but just created rubble that favored the defenders (e.g., Monte Cassino, Stalingrad).
